UserID: 1 | After I spent about 5 hours on the site, I went down into my lab and started working on my 2700. The thing that prevents the pump from coming off was broken off completely, so I had to fix it. I used a 2L bottle cap with a hole in it to prevent the pump from coming out, and then I hot glued the thing that busted off back on. That worked pretty good. The pump is feeling kinda flimsy, so maybe later I'm going to put a dowel rod in it. Since my 2700 was still open, I finally partially K modded it. I only had 10 balloons left, but already it's feeling a lot more powerful. It actually has kick now, and more than I expected. The range increased a lot, before with the nozzle selector off it got like 35 feet range. Now, it gets over 45 foot range. I did the "accurate" 1 stride = 3 feet method and got 63 feet. That was wrong, so I used a tape measurer and got 46 feet. I can't wait until I get more balloons, it's going to be great. I love the feeling of power in my hands.
